The Catholic Church of Philadelphia has partnered with Hallow as part of the ongoing Trust & Hope initiative led by Archbishop Nelson J. Pérez to foster growth in the spirit of Missionary Discipleship.

“The Church’s door has always been open,” said Archbishop Nelson J. Pérez. “Trust & Hope makes our local Church face outward to all. It invites people to come closer and look inside. Hallow helps them encounter God in the quiet of their own hearts.”

Through this partnership, the five regional Missionary Hubs — along with an additional parish community — will incorporate Hallow into their existing evangelization and outreach efforts through:

• Guided prayer experiences
• Small group and faith-sharing opportunities
• Seasonal Advent and Lent reflections
• Digital resources to help individuals and families grow closer to God
• Free Hallow accounts for clergy, seminarians, and religious brothers and sisters.
Additionally, all parishes and schools in the Archdiocese get access to a 10% diocesan level discount for any parishes or schools who wish to purchase a Hallow Parish Partnership Package.

Recently, I was honored to be elected to The Papal Foundation Board of Trustees.

Since its inception in 1988, The Papal Foundation and its Stewards of Saint Peter have allocated $250 million in grants and scholarships around the world to more than 2000 projects selected by recent popes.

As Metropolitan Archbishop of Philadelphia, I am deeply disturbed and saddened by the Commonwealth Court of Pennsylvania’s recent ruling overturning our state’s ban on the utilization of public funding for elective abortions. In effect, the court is forcing all taxpayers to fund abortions and proclaiming a constitutional right to end the life of an unborn child.

As Catholics, we believe that life is God’s most precious gift and that we share a responsibility to uphold its sanctity for all people from conception to natural death.

The Church’s strong commitment in this regard is a holistic one. We advocate strongly for the unborn, who cannot speak for themselves. At the same time, we work tirelessly to care for the needs of the hungry, the poor, the sick, the immigrant, the elderly, the oppressed, and all those who are marginalized with dignity and grace.

It is my hope and prayer that immediate action will be taken to reinstate the ban on public funding for abortions, and that all Pennsylvanians will work to sustain a true culture of respect for life.

Most Reverend Nelson J. Pérez, D.D.
Archbishop of Philadelphia

Pope Leo XIV has consistently spoken with clarity and compassion with calls for peaceful resolutions to complex challenges in a manner that upholds the sanctity and dignity of all human life as our world continues to be afflicted with division, conflict, and suffering. Both the Holy Father and his message deserve respect and admiration.

As a pastoral and world leader, Pope Leo XIV is a gift for Catholics and all people of good will. His message powerfully reflects the truth of the Gospel.

While many expect political messages from the Vicar of Christ, it is his role to preach the Gospel of peace and the role of political leaders to secure the most efficient end to world conflict and division.

His continued calls for peace, hope, diplomacy, and the conversion of hearts should be heeded by all. The Church of Philadelphia stands by the Holy Father as he continues to call and pray for world peace as he has done since the beginning of his pontificate.

Most Reverend Nelson J. Pérez, D.D.
Archbishop of Philadelphia
